Basic HTML Formatting Concepts PDF
Document Details
Uploaded by ProgressiveBauhaus
UiTM
Tags
Summary
This document provides practice questions for basic HTML formatting concepts, and covers the use of CSS for advanced font styling methods.
Full Transcript
Basic HTML Formatting Concepts Question Answer What are the learning objectives of IMD208 on Basic HTML At the end of this chapter, students should be able to: Formatting? 1...
Basic HTML Formatting Concepts Question Answer What are the learning objectives of IMD208 on Basic HTML At the end of this chapter, students should be able to: Formatting? 1. Specify different sizes of font that can be used for headings. 2. Apply different font formatting. What is the primary tag used for font formatting in HTML? The primary tag for font element in HTML is the tag. What are the attributes of the tag in HTML? The tag has three attributes: 1. size - Specifies the size of the font. 2. face - Specifies the typeface (font family). 3. color - Specifies the color of the font. What is a good practice for managing font colors and sizes in It is a good practice to use Cascading Style Sheets (CSS) to set web pages? the font color and size for the whole web pages. Why is it important to specify different sizes of font for headings? Specifying different sizes of font for headings is important to create a hierarchy of information, improving the readability and organization of content on web pages. What should students be able to apply regarding font formatting Students should be able to apply different font formatting based on the learning objectives? techniques to enhance the visual presentation of text in their web content. Describe how the tag is deprecated in HTML5. In HTML5, the tag is deprecated, and it is recommended to use CSS for all styling purposes, including font color, size, and family. Which CSS properties can be used to achieve similar results to The following CSS properties can be used: the tag? 1. font-size - to set the font size. 2. font-family - to set the typeface. 3. color - to set the font color. Provide an example of how to use CSS to style text in HTML. Example CSS code: ```css h1 { font-size: 24px; font-family: Arial, sans-serif; color: blue; } ``` This styles all headers with a font size of 24 pixels, Arial font, and blue color. What are the benefits of using CSS over the tag for font Benefits of using CSS include: styling? 1. Separation of content and presentation, promoting cleaner HTML. 2. Ease of maintaining and updating styles across multiple pages. 3. More flexibility and control over styling options. What is the function of the HTML tag? The tag contains metadata about the HTML document, such as the title, scripts, and styles. It is not displayed on the webpage itself. What is the purpose of the tag in HTML? The tag sets the title of the webpage, which is displayed in the browser's title bar or tab. It is important for SEO and user experience. How do you create bold text in HTML? To make text bold in HTML, you can use the or tags. Both have the same visual effect, but is preferred for semantic importance. How can text be italicized in HTML? Text can be italicized using the or tags. Similar to bold text, is preferred for emphasizing meaning. What does the tag do in HTML? The tag increases the font size of the enclosed text, making it appear larger on the webpage. Question Answer What is the function of the tag in HTML? The tag decreases the font size of the enclosed text, making it appear smaller on the webpage. What is the difference between and tags? The tag is used to create subscript text, which is displayed lower than the baseline, while the tag creates superscript text, which is displayed higher than the baseline. Why is it important to open and close HTML tags in the same Opening and closing HTML tags in the same order is important order? for ensuring proper display and functionality of the webpage. Incorrectly nested tags can lead to rendering issues and unexpected behaviors. What is the overall goal of text formatting in web design? The overall goal of text formatting in web design is to enhance the readability, accessibility, and visual hierarchy of the content, making it easier for users to engage with the information presented. Explain the importance of using both and tags within Using and tags within other elements helps to create HTML elements. visually distinct text that enhances understanding and emphasis. It allows designers to appropriately highlight important information without altering the document structure. What are the purposes of using italics in web content? Italics should be used to highlight key words or phrases, emphasizing text or words rather than for stylizing or shaping the font face. What are the two commonly used HTML tags to create italics on The two commonly used HTML tags for italics are and. a website? How does the browser interpret and tags? Browsers generally interpret and tags in a similar way, both rendering text in italics. What does the HTML code This text is bold do? The tag makes the enclosed text bold, displaying it more prominently. What is the syntax for making text bold in HTML? The syntax for bold text in HTML is using the tag, like this: This text is bold. How do you write italic text in HTML using both and To write italic text using , you would use the syntax This tags? text is italic. For , the syntax is This text is italic. What does the HTML code This text is italic bold It produces text that is both italicized and bolded, making it stand produce? out with both font styles applied. How can you change the size, color, and face of text in web You can change the size, color, and face of text by using CSS design? (Cascading Style Sheets) properties such as 'font-size', 'color', and 'font-family'. What is the significance of proper text formatting in web content Proper text formatting ensures readability, enhances user management? experience, and conveys information effectively by emphasizing important points and organizing content. What is the purpose of the tag in HTML? The tag is used to specify the font size, face, and color of text on a webpage. List the three main attributes of the tag. The three main attributes of the tag are size, color, and face. What is the syntax to change the font color to red using the The syntax is: This text is red. tag? What is the syntax to change the font size to 16 using the The syntax is: This text size is 16. tag? What is the syntax to change the font face to Arial using the The syntax is: This text face is Arial. tag? Provide an example of using the tag to change both size Example: This text is red and size is and color of text. 16. Question Answer Is the tag still recommended for use in modern HTML No, the tag is deprecated in HTML5. It is recommended to standards? use CSS (Cascading Style Sheets) for styling text. What is an alternative method to specify font color without using An alternative method is to use CSS with the 'color' property, for the tag? example: This text is red. What is an alternative method to specify font size without using An alternative method is to use CSS with the 'font-size' property, the tag? for example: This text size is 16. What is an alternative method to specify font face without using An alternative method is to use CSS with the 'font-family' the tag? property, for example: This text face is Arial. What effect does the have on text display? The makes the text very small; HTML size values range from 1 (smallest) to 7 (largest), with 3 being the default. When using the tag, what does the 'face' attribute specify? The 'face' attribute specifies the type of font to be displayed, such as Arial, Times New Roman, etc. How would one change font attributes for an entire webpage in a By including CSS in the section of the HTML document modern website design? or linking to a CSS stylesheet to define font properties globally. What is the significance of HTML semantic elements in modern HTML semantic elements provide meaning to the webpage web design compared to deprecated elements like ? content, enhance accessibility, and help with SEO, while deprecated elements like do not convey meaning and are not supported in modern standards. What is the significance of using color in web design? Using color in web design creates a favorable first impression and plays a key role in user experience. The right colors can evoke emotions, convey meanings, and enhance visual appeal. How many colors should generally be used in a single web page It is suggested that no more than three colors should be used on design? one web page to maintain a cohesive and visually appealing design. What should the main theme of color be in web design? The main theme of the colors selected should be consistent and used throughout the entire web pages to ensure a unified look and feel. What is a common misconception regarding background and text Many webmasters state that a dark background with light text is color? easier to read; however, most websites adopt a light background with dark text. Why do most websites use a light background with dark text? The preference for a light background with dark text is largely due to longstanding habits of writing on light-colored paper with dark ink, which users are accustomed to. Additionally, the default web page color is white, and the default text color is black. What are some standard color settings used for web pages? The default color settings for most web pages are a white background with black text, which are often maintained for ease of use and familiarity. What is the impact of color choice on user experience in web Color choice significantly impacts user experience by influencing design? readability, navigation, and emotional response, which can ultimately affect how users perceive and interact with the website. What design principle should be followed when selecting colors When selecting colors for a webpage, consistency and simplicity for a webpage? should be prioritized; limiting color usage to two or three main colors can help achieve this. What is the significance of the main color on a web page? The main color on a web page, which is usually the background color, defines the overall aesthetic and user experience of the page. It is crucial in determining how the other design elements will fit together, influencing the page's visual worthiness. How do you add a background color to a web page? To add a background color to a web page, use the bgcolor attribute in the body tag of the HTML. For example:. Question Answer What is problematic about using a text color similar to the Using a text color that is similar to the background color makes background color? the text nearly invisible, making it difficult for users to read and engage with the content. What should be considered when choosing a text color to When choosing a text color, it should not be too similar to the complement the background color? background color, as this will lose readability. Additionally, it should not be overly contrasting, as high contrast can cause eye strain and deter users from reading the text. What HTML tag contains the bgcolor attribute to set the The bgcolor attribute is set in the tag of the HTML background color? document. What is the impact of color scheme on user experience in web A well-thought-out color scheme enhances visual appeal, aids in design? readability, and creates a pleasant user experience, while poor color choices can lead to confusion, frustration, and increased bounce rates. Explain the potential effects of high color contrast in web design. High color contrast can lead to eye strain for users and might make the content difficult to read. It’s important to find a balance that makes the text easy to read without causing discomfort. What role does color play in defining the 'worthiness' of a web Color plays a pivotal role in aesthetic appeal and cohesion of page? design elements, which can influence users' perceptions of professionalism and credibility, thus defining whether a web page appears worthy or worthless. What does the 'bgcolor' attribute specify in HTML? The 'bgcolor' attribute specifies a background color for an HTML page. The value of this attribute can be a hexadecimal number, an RGB (Red, Green, Blue) value, or a color name. What is the hexadecimal value for black in HTML? The hexadecimal value for black in HTML is '#000000'. How can you specify a background color in RGB format in HTML? You can specify a background color in RGB format using the syntax 'rgb(0, 0, 0)' for black, where the three numbers represent the intensities of red, green, and blue respectively. What is an example of using a color name to set a background An example of using a color name to set a background color in color in HTML? HTML is 'body bgcolor="black"'. List at least five W3C standard color names. W3C standard color names include: Aqua, Black, Blue, Fuchsia, Gray, Green, Lime, Maroon, Navy, Olive, Purple, Red, Silver, Teal, White, Yellow. What is preformatted text in HTML and how is it denoted? Preformatted text in HTML is text that is rendered using a fixed- width font, where whitespace characters, such as spaces and line breaks, are preserved. It is denoted using the tag. What effect does using a background image have on text contrast Using a background image can significantly affect the contrast of in web design? the text, making it either easier or harder to read depending on how the colors and patterns of the text and image interact. What type of font is used for text within the tags in HTML? Text within the tags in HTML is rendered using a fixed- width font. What is the purpose of the tag in HTML? The purpose of the tag in HTML is to display preformatted text, preserving spaces and line breaks, and using a fixed-width font to maintain the original formatting. What is the purpose of the tag in HTML? The tag in HTML is used to define preformatted text. It preserves both spaces and line breaks in the text enclosed within it, allowing the text to be displayed exactly as written, maintaining the formatting that includes whitespace. What type of content is typically marked up with the The tag is used to markup blocks of text that are tag in HTML? quoted from another source. This can include quotations from a person or another document, and it may consist of a few lines or several paragraphs. Question Answer Explain how whitespace is handled in HTML elements compared In HTML, most elements collapse repeated whitespace to the element. characters into a single space character, and line breaks are inserted automatically. In contrast, the element does not collapse whitespaces or line breaks, displaying the text exactly as it was written. Can the element contain multiple paragraphs? If Yes, the element can contain multiple paragraphs. so, explain why this feature is useful. This is useful as it allows the entire context of a quotation to be included, providing clarity and maintaining the original structure of the quoted text, which is important for proper attribution and comprehension. What is the significance of preserving whitespace and formatting Preserving whitespace and formatting in web design is significant in web design? because it enhances readability and ensures that the visual presentation of the text matches the intended design. It allows for the inclusion of structured layouts such as code, poetry, or tabulated data, which are crucial for user engagement and information accessibility. What is a primary guideline for choosing fonts in web design? One primary guideline for choosing fonts in web design is to avoid changing fonts too frequently within a web page. Selecting a consistent font helps maintain readability and user experience. What should beginners in web design avoid doing with fonts? Beginners in web design should avoid using too many different fonts and experimenting with fonts that are difficult to read. Often, they choose fonts solely for their appearance without considering usability. What is a 'serif' in typography? A serif is a small decorative line added as a stroke to the end of a larger stroke in a letter or symbol within a particular font. What are 'sans-serif' fonts? Sans-serif fonts are types of fonts that do not have serifs, meaning they are clean without the decorative ends. They are often recommended for web content due to their readability on screens. What is the significance of using sans-serif fonts in web design? Sans-serif fonts are significant in web design because they enhance readability, especially on digital screens, making them a preferred choice for web content. Why do designers sometimes choose 'cool' fonts? Designers sometimes choose 'cool' fonts to achieve aesthetic appeal or create a specific vibe; however, this can lead to reduced readability and effectiveness of the content. How do fonts impact the design of a web page? Fonts greatly influence the visual impact, tone, and readability of a web page. A well-chosen font can enhance the user experience, while poor choices can distract or frustrate users. What is an example of a professional source for web design Professional sources for web design principles include principles? educational institutions, established designers, and curated web design resources such as books, online courses, and academic papers. What is an important check when designing website content? An important check when designing website content is to ensure that the font choices enhance clarity and do not sacrifice user experience for aesthetic reasons. Why is consistency important in web font usage? Consistency in web font usage is important because it helps establish a cohesive brand identity, improves user navigation, and keeps the focus on the content itself. Why should sans-serif fonts be used for web design? Sans-serif fonts should be used for web design because computer monitors have lower resolution than paper, making serif fonts harder to read. The little serifs can blur together on a screen, leading to decreased readability. What are some examples of sans-serif fonts? Examples of sans-serif fonts include Arial, Geneva, Helvetica, Lucida Sans, Trebuchet, and Verdana. Question Answer What was special about Verdana as a font? Verdana was specifically designed for use on the Web, making it ideal for web pages due to its readability at various screen sizes. What is the general guideline for using serif fonts versus sans- Serif fonts should be used for print materials, while sans-serif serif fonts? fonts should be used for web page main copy to enhance readability. What can happen if serif fonts are used on web pages? If serif fonts are used on web pages, the serifs may blur together on lower resolution screens, making the text harder to read and potentially leading to a negative user experience. What are the implications of font choice in web content The choice of font in web content management design can management design? significantly affect the readability and aesthetic appeal of the website. Using appropriate fonts enhances user experience and ensures that text is legible on various devices. What are serif fonts and their benefits for print? Serif fonts are typefaces that have small decorative lines or 'serifs' at the ends of their letters. They are beneficial for print because they make it easier to read, allowing people to differentiate the letters more clearly. Print has a higher resolution than screens, which helps the serifs to be visible and avoid letters blurring together. List some examples of serif fonts. Examples of serif fonts include: Garamond, Georgia, New York, Times, and Times New Roman. Why are serif fonts considered hard to read online? Serif fonts are considered hard to read online primarily because screens have lower resolution compared to print, which may cause the serifs to appear blurry or indistinct, making it difficult for the viewer to easily differentiate between letters. What is a monospace font? A monospace font is a typeface where each character occupies the same amount of horizontal space. This uniformity makes it suitable for displaying code examples, providing instructions, or portraying typewritten text. What is the historical significance of monospace fonts? Monospace fonts were commonly used in typewriters, where each letter had a fixed width that contributed to the readability and formatting of the typed text. What are some examples of monospace fonts? Examples of monospace fonts include: Courier, Courier New, and Lucida Console. In what scenarios should monospace fonts be used on a website?Monospace fonts should be used for code examples, technical documentation, instructions, or to imply typewritten text, even if the website's main content is not computing-related. What is the primary reason serif fonts work better in print The primary reason is that print environments have higher compared to online? resolution, which helps in clearly displaying the serifs and distinguishing each letter, thus enhancing readability. What are the visual characteristics of serif and monospace fonts? Serif fonts have decorative lines or features at the end of strokes in letters, while monospace fonts have a consistent character width, where each character occupies an equal amount of space regardless of its shape. Why should fantasy or cursive fonts be avoided for body text in Fantasy and cursive fonts are not widely supported on web design? computers, making them difficult to read in large chunks. They may present challenges for non-native speakers and often lack essential accent or special characters, limiting the text to English. In what scenarios can fantasy and cursive fonts be appropriately Fantasy and cursive fonts can be used in images and as used? headlines or call-outs, but they should be kept short to ensure readability. What are the potential issues with using cursive fonts in web Cursive fonts may pose readability challenges for non-native content for an international audience? speakers, making the text harder to understand and engage with, which could negatively impact user experience. Question Answer What key considerations should be made when selecting a font When selecting a font, consider its readability, support for for web content? different characters, compatibility across devices and browsers, and whether it is commonly available on readers' computers. What is the general guideline for font choice in body text The general guideline is to avoid fantasy and cursive fonts for according to the document? body text due to their readability issues and limited character support. How can one incorporate fantasy and cursive fonts into a web Incorporate fantasy and cursive fonts in a limited manner, such design effectively? as in images or as short headlines, ensuring that they do not compromise overall readability and user experience. What specific characteristics might be missing in fantasy and Fantasy and cursive fonts may lack accent characters and other cursive fonts that are problematic for web content? special characters, which limits text representation to English and reduces accessibility for speakers of other languages. What are some examples of fantasy fonts? Some examples of fantasy fonts include Copperplate, Desdemona, Impact, and Kino. Which font is classified as a fantasy font and known for its Copperplate is a fantasy font known for its elegant and formal elegant, formal appearance? appearance. Name a fantasy font that is often used for eye-catching headlines. Impact is a fantasy font often used for bold headlines, What is its notable feature? characterized by its thick strokes and heavy presence. What is Desdemona, and in what context might it be used? Desdemona is a fantasy font, typically used in contexts where a dramatic or artistic flair is desired, such as in creative designs or graphic titles. What are script fonts, and how do they differ from other font Script fonts are fonts that mimic handwritten text with flowing, categories? cursive letters, often used for invitations, greeting cards, or any design that requires a personal touch. List three examples of script fonts. Three examples of script fonts are Comic Sans MS, Lucida Handwriting, and Zapf Chancery. What is Comic Sans MS, and why is it often criticized despite Comic Sans MS is a casual script font that is often criticized for being a script font? being unprofessional and overly simplistic, making it less suitable for formal documents. Describe the characteristics of Lucida Handwriting. Lucida Handwriting is a script font that features a natural, flowing style that closely resembles cursive writing, making it popular for informal documents, invitations, and greeting cards. What is Zapf Chancery, and what makes it unique compared to Zapf Chancery is a unique script font characterized by its elegant other script fonts? calligraphic form, often used in formal invitations and artistic designs.